I knew this year that defending the Cascadia Cup title was going to be more difficult. The way the schedule worked out we had four games on the road and only two at home. Portland got four at home and two away. But we are right there to defend our title. We need to win on Sunday and then get some help from Vancouver. We are ready and cannot wait to take the field on Sunday.
Last week we clinched a playoff spot for the fourth year in a row and also got our first shutout in a while. That was the good news, but we also got shut out and we are not happy about that. We had chances, with Evans, Johnson, Montero, Parke and Zakuani getting close. This week we need to convert those chances to goals.
Even though we are going to the playoffs again, there is a resolve that I sense in this team that we want to accomplish more than last year. When we made the playoffs there were no celebrations like last year because that is not our end goal.
